The market is categorized into Host-based, Wireless-based, and Network-based IDS & IPS architectures. Each architecture addresses specific deployment needs, ranging from endpoint protection to large-scale network surveillance, driven by increasing cloud adoption and IoT device proliferation.
-
Host-based IDS & IPS
These systems monitor individual devices or servers. They are vital for preventing insider threats and ensuring endpoint-level security within hybrid enterprise environments.
-
Wireless-based IDS & IPS
This sub-segment addresses security vulnerabilities in wireless networks. Rising adoption of Wi-Fi 6 and expanding mobile connectivity are accelerating growth in this category.
-
Network-based IDS & IPS
These systems monitor entire network infrastructures, analyzing traffic to detect anomalies. The growing complexity of enterprise networks has made this approach crucial for real-time detection and mitigation of sophisticated cyberattacks.
Intrusion Detection System (IDS) And Intrusion Prevention System (IPS) Market, Segmentation by Detection Method
Based on detection methodology, the market is segmented into Signature-based, Anomaly-based, and Policy-based systems. The integration of machine learning and AI-driven algorithms has enhanced detection accuracy, improving both preventive and corrective responses.
-
Signature-based
Utilizes known threat databases for rapid identification. Although traditional, it remains widely adopted due to its high accuracy and low false-positive rate.
-
Anomaly-based
Focuses on identifying deviations from normal behavior. It is gaining traction with the rise of zero-day threats and AI-enhanced analytics.
-
Policy-based
Employs predefined rules and configurations to monitor compliance and activity. This approach is critical for ensuring regulatory adherence and internal governance.

- Complexity in Deployment: Implementing IDS/IPS solutions can be complex and resource-intensive, requiring specialized knowledge and expertise in network security. Organizations may face challenges in deploying, configuring, and maintaining IDS/IPS systems, especially in heterogeneous IT environments with diverse hardware, software, and network architectures.Organizations often operate complex network infrastructures comprising multiple segments, locations, and interconnected systems. Deploying IDS/IPS solutions across such diverse environments requires a comprehensive understanding of the network topology, traffic patterns, and potential points of vulnerability.
Integrating IDS/IPS solutions with existing security infrastructure, such as firewalls, SIEM (Security Information and Event Management) systems, and endpoint security solutions, can be challenging. Ensuring seamless interoperability and data exchange between different security components is crucial for achieving comprehensive threat detection and response capabilities.
IDS/IPS systems can introduce latency and overhead to network traffic due to the inspection and analysis processes they perform. Balancing the need for comprehensive threat detection with minimal performance impact is essential to avoid degradation of network performance and user experience. Meeting regulatory compliance requirements, such as GDPR, HIPAA, PCI DSS, and others, adds another layer of complexity to IDS/IPS deployment. Ensuring that IDS/IPS systems capture and report relevant security events, maintain audit trails, and adhere to compliance frameworks is critical for organizations operating in regulated industries.
